The Evolution of 3D Printing Machines in China

The evolution of 3D printing machines in China has been remarkable, marked by rapid advancements and increased global competitiveness. According to a report from Statista, the Chinese 3D printing market is expected to grow from approximately $1.37 billion in 2020 to over $7.2 billion by 2025, reflecting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 40%. This exponential growth can be attributed to China's significant investments in research and development, along with government policies that support innovation in additive manufacturing.

Chinese manufacturers have made significant strides in various sectors, including aerospace, automotive, and healthcare, harnessing the capabilities of 3D printing machines to improve production efficiency and reduce costs. For instance, Huasha Medical's 3D printing technology has been utilized to create customizable prosthetics and implants, demonstrating the technology's potential in the medical field. Additionally, the introduction of metal 3D printing has allowed Chinese companies to produce complex components with high precision, positioning them as leaders in the global market. According to a report by Mordor Intelligence, the metal 3D printing segment in China is projected to grow at a CAGR of 33% from 2021 to 2026, further showcasing the country's commitment to advancing the 3D printing landscape.

Key Industries Benefiting from China's 3D Printing Advancements

China has established itself as a frontrunner in the 3D printing industry, with significant advancements that are reshaping various key sectors. In healthcare, for instance, Chinese companies are pioneering the development of custom prosthetics and implants, allowing for tailored patient-specific solutions that enhance recovery and comfort. These innovations not only improve the quality of care but also streamline production processes, making them faster and more cost-effective.

Moreover, the aerospace and automotive industries are reaping the benefits of China's robust 3D printing technology. By enabling rapid prototyping and producing lightweight components, manufacturers are able to enhance fuel efficiency and reduce material waste. This transformative approach is redefining traditional manufacturing, leading to a more sustainable and resource-efficient future.
